Quick recap from chapter 7....


Joshua sent about 3,000 men to try and take over Ai, but they were chased out and they were defeated. It made the Israelites lose heart.

It wasn't until Joshua dropped to his knees and he asked the Lord "why did you bring us here just to let us fall?"

and the Lord Said "Isreal has Sinned"

He went on to say "They have violated my covenant. They have taken what was set apart. They have stolen. They have deceived, and because of this they will not stand against their enemies, and I cannot be with them. "


If you remember it was Only Achan that took from Jericho, but if you go back to Joshua ch 6:18 the Lord tells them " But keep yourselves from the things set apart or you will be set apart for destruction. If you take any of those things you will set apart the camp of Israel for destruction, and make trouble for it."


So, because of one man the whole camp fell!


So they were told to go and consecrate, and then remove what is set apart. Whoever was caught with the things that were set apart must be burned along with everything he has because he had violated the Lord's covenant and committed an outrage in Israel.


So at the end of chapter 7 they found out it was Achan who had stolen. So Achan and his sons and daughters were all stoned and then burned along with the things he had stolen. Then the Lord turned from His burning anger.



So at the beginning of chapter 8...


The Lord told Joshua "Do not be afraid or discouraged take all the troops with you and go back to Ai and attack them"


He also told them not Only would he hand over Ai like he did Jericho, but He would also let them plunder the spoil and livestock this time.... IF ONLY Achan would have just been Loyal and waited!!!!

Joshua and all the troops set out to go attack Ai, and this time they were given a different set of instructions. Within those instructions a few key points were....

Pay attention....

Be Ready...

and Follow the Lords command.


So early the next morning Joshua and the elders led the people up to Ai. He set out about 5,000 to the West of the city to ambush, and all the rest were set up on the North side.


When the King of Ai saw the Israelites the men of the city hurried and engaged Israel in Battle.

Little did they know there would be an ambush behind them!

So, Joshua and all Israel pretended to be beaten back and ran towards the wilderness. The troops of Ai were then summoned to pursue them, and not a man was left in Ai or Bethel who did not go after Israel. Which left their whole city exposed.


In that moment the Lord told Joshua "Hold out the javelin in your hand towards Ai for I will hand the city over to you"

So, Joshua held out his hand and when he did the men in ambush ran into the city, captured it, and set it on fire.


The men of Ai looked back and seen the city on fire, but there was no escaping in any direction at this point.


Now Joshua and the men of Israel started striking down the men of Ai, and then the men that were in ambush came out of the city against them as well. So they were trapped in between both forces, and all of them were struck down except for the king.


He was taken to Joshua and then he was hung on a tree until that evening. At sunset they took his body down, placed it at the entrance of the city gates, and put a large pile of rocks over him.

They then went up to Mount Ebel to build an altar in which Moses had previously commanded. They offered burnt offerings, fellowship, and Joshua also read all of the Words of the Law. There was Not a word of all that Moses Commanded that Joshua didn't read.
